We want to create a system that has a fixed number of available usernames, 2000. The names are provided at the end of this proposal. Users come to the page and are asked: Would you like a male or a female username? Then, from the list they are shown three random names. They chose the name they like the best. This will be their username. A password is assigned to the username. A message is displayed to the user: Your password will be mailed to you after five working days. It should show the user the date that would be. In three working days, the username and password is emailed to the admin email. In 5 working days the username and password is emailed to the user. An online, password protected table needs to be kept of usernames assigned, and unassigned. Aditionally, in the table there needs to be some way to note a username as blocked, and the date it was blocked. The population of usernames will diminsh over time. Admin needs to be able to add names to the unassigned names as they decrease. Names Source: [login to view URL] ADDITIONAL FEATURES: Hello. THere are two additional features that we discovered the code will need. Please consider them. Thank you all for your interest in our project. 1.) A Lost Passwword function, that emails the password to the user, and a note to admin that such a request was made, plus a change password. 2.) A Change Password function, that sends the password to the user in 3 working days, and the request to Admin is sent immediately.
## Deliverables
1) Complete and fully-functional working program(s) in executable form as well as complete source code of all work done.
2) Deliverables must be in ready-to-run condition, as follows? (depending on the nature? of the deliverables):
a)? For web sites or? other server-side deliverables intended to only ever exist in one place in the Buyer's environment--Deliverables must be installed by the Seller in ready-to-run condition in the Buyer's environment.
b) For all others including desktop software or software the buyer intends to distribute: A software? installation package that will install the software in ready-to-run condition on the platform(s) specified in this bid request.
3) All deliverables will be considered "work made for hire" under U.S. Copyright law. Buyer will receive exclusive and complete copyrights to all work purchased. (No GPL, GNU, 3rd party components, etc. unless all copyright ramifications are explained AND AGREED TO by the buyer on the site per the coder's Seller Legal Agreement).
## Platform
Unix Box Web Deployment